本文主要介绍了芮城h5小程序开发的技巧与实践,深入浅出地阐述了小程序的基本概念和构成部分,详细介绍了开发小程序需要掌握的技术和注意事项,通过实际案例演示,让读者更好地理解和应用这些技巧。
1. 深入了解小程序的概念和构成部分
小程序是一种轻量级的应用程序,基于微信公众号的原生开发框架实现,具有体积小、加载快、使用简单等特点。它由三个部分组成:界面、逻辑和数据,其中界面用于展示数据和交互,逻辑负责实现功能和业务逻辑,数据则是界面和逻辑之间的桥梁。
2. 掌握开发小程序需要的技术和注意事项
开发小程序需要掌握一些基本技术和注意事项,如HTML、CSS、JavaScript等前端技术,以及微信小程序API、开发工具、调试技巧等。此外,开发者还需要注意用户体验、代码优化、安全性等方面的问题,以保证小程序的稳定性和良好的用户体验。
3. 如何设计小程序的界面和功能
设计小程序的界面和功能需要根据实际需求和用户习惯来确定,可以采用一些常用的UI设计模式和交互方式,如tab切换、下拉刷新、上拉加载等。同时,也可以加入一些特殊效果与动画,使小程序更加生动、有趣。
4. 利用API实现小程序的功能和特效
API是小程序开发不可缺少的一部分,通过调用API可以实现小程序的各种功能和特效,如获取用户信息、操作网络请求、利用地图和定位功能、实现小程序内购等。开发者需要深入理解它们的使用方法和特点,以根据实际需求制定合适的编程方案。
5. 实际案例演示:一个简单的计算器小程序
最后,通过一个实际案例——一个简单的计算器小程序,来演示如何开发一个小程序并实现相应的功能。在介绍实现细节的同时,还有一些实用的技巧和知识点,如使用盒子模型实现布局、利用wx:for循环实现数据绑定等。
总之,芮城h5小程序的开发涉及到多个方面,需要开发者具备一定的前端技术基础和开发经验,也需要注意小程序的用户体验和代码质量。相信通过本文的介绍,读者可以更好地理解和应用小程序的开发技巧,为实现更好的小程序应用程序打下坚实的基础。
本文将深入浅出地详解芮城h5小程序的开发技巧与实践。芮城h5小程序是一种基于HTML、CSS和JS的轻量级应用,可以在微信、支付宝等平台上运行,为用户提供更加便捷、快速的服务。本文将从框架搭建、页面设计、数据交互、优化技巧等多个方面进行介绍,帮助读者全面掌握芮城h5小程序的开发技术。
1. 框架搭建
芮城h5小程序采用Vue.js框架作为开发工具,因为Vue.js具有轻量、易学、易上手、易维护等优点,非常适合快速开发小型项目。在搭建框架时,需要配置webpack、babel、eslint等环境,并封装公用组件、路由等模块。同时,为了提高开发效率,可以使用UI框架来快速实现页面UI设计,如Element UI、Mint UI等。
2. 页面设计
在页面设计方面,需要注意响应式设计和适配不同终端。可以通过CSS3中的媒体查询来实现不同终端的适配,同时也需要考虑到用户体验的设计,如交互设计、动画效果等。为了提高页面加载速度和用户体验,可以采用图片懒加载、页面预加载、减少HTTP请求等优化技巧。
3. 数据交互
在数据交互方面,可以使用HTTP协议和Ajax技术来实现前后端数据的交互。同时,也可以采用WebSocket实现实时通信功能,如聊天室、在线游戏等。为了保证数据交互的安全性,需要使用HTTPS协议,并对用户输入进行严格验证、过滤,防止SQL注入、跨站脚本攻击等安全问题。
4. 优化技巧
在优化技巧方面,可以采用以下技巧来提高芮城h5小程序的性能和用户体验:
- 合并压缩CSS、JS文件以减少HTTP请求;
- 使用缓存技术来提高页面访问速度,并设置缓存时效;
- 使用CDN加速技术来提高图片、JS等文件的加载速度;
- 避免使用JS操作DOM,尽量减少重绘重排等性能损耗。
5. 实际案例
为了更好地理解芮城h5小程序的开发技巧与实践,本文给出一个实际案例。该案例为一个“在线选座”小程序,主要功能为用户可以在小程序中选择电影院、电影、场次、座位,完成购票流程。在该案例中,涉及到用户交互、数据交互、支付接口等技术。
芮城h5小程序是一种轻量、快速、便捷的应用,可以为用户提供更好的服务体验。本文从框架搭建、页面设计、数据交互、优化技巧和实际案例等多个方面进行了详细介绍,希望能够对读者有所帮助。同时,需要注意的是,在开发芮城h5小程序时,需要充分考虑到用户体验、数据安全、应用性能等方面,为用户提供更好的服务。